What Are the Benefits of Global Outsourcing?
NoonDalton
DECEMBER 21, 2022
The term “outsourcing” refers to a business activity when a corporation employs a third party to carry out duties, manage operations, or offer services on the firm’s behalf. Offshoring is another name for global outsourcing, which is the practice of outsourcing work to a third party headquartered abroad.
Let's personalize your content